Description

Crane Gearbox is an important transmission component in crane systems. It connects the motor with the hoisting, trolley travelling, or crane travelling mechanism, reducing motor speed while increasing output torque to support stable crane movement and heavy-load lifting operation.

The gearbox is commonly used in bridge cranes, gantry cranes, container cranes, yard cranes, rubber tired gantry cranes, hoists, trolleys, and other power-driven lifting equipment. According to the working position, it can be selected for hoisting motion, cross travel, or long travel applications.

A crane gearbox normally works through a set of meshing gears inside the housing. The motor output shaft transmits power to the gearbox input shaft, the internal gear ratio changes speed and torque, and the output shaft delivers controlled power to the crane mechanism. A properly selected gearbox helps improve operating stability, load handling capability, positioning performance, and service life.

For crane applications, gearbox selection should consider motor power, output torque, gear ratio, installation form, shaft arrangement, duty cycle, working environment, lubrication, sealing, noise control, and maintenance access. For replacement projects, the existing gearbox model, nameplate, mounting dimensions, shaft size, and working mechanism should be confirmed before quotation.
